Any thought on redone Dwarf above?
It is good.
I like it.
1 more hp for everone is great.
Ignoring exhaustion is also great.
All enforces dwarves are very resilient without having a stat bonus.

Only one quibble: I would like a per short rest power for every race.
So maybe instead of ignoring exhaustion alltogether (which is very strong), I would add:
Bonus action: spend a hit die and regain hp as if you had a short rest. For the next ten minutes, you can ignore the effect of exhaustion.
